colonnade
noun
/ˌkɒl.əˈneɪd/
Meaning
A row of evenly spaced columns supporting a roof, often in classical architecture.
Example Sentences
The visitors admired the grand
colonnade
at the entrance of the temple.
Synonyms
row of columns, arcade, portico, peristyle
Antonyms
wall, barrier
Collocations
grand colonnade, stone colonnade, temple colonnade, classical colonnade
